Abstract

Disclosed herein is a method for producing a 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ine. The method comprises forming a reaction mixture comprising at least one substituted or unsubstituted phenolphthalein compound, at least one substituted or unsubstituted primary hydrocarbyl amine, and an acid catalyst; and heating the reaction mixture to form 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ine. An adduct of the 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ine is formed either by using an excess of the primary hydrocarbyl amine in the first heating step, or by isolating crude 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ine after the heating step and then reacting with a further amount of the primary hydrocarbyl amine. The 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ine has a formula: where R 1 is selected from the group consisting of a hydrogen and a hydrocarbyl group, and R 2 is selected from the group consisting of a hydrogen, a hydrocarbyl group, and a halogen.

Claims (36)

1. A method for producing a 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ine of Formula (I),

said method comprising:

(A) heating a reaction mixture comprising:

(i) a primary hydrocarbyl amine of Formula (II),

—R 1 —NH2,

(ii) a phenolphthalein compound of Formula (III),

wherein R 1 is selected from a group consisting of a hydrogen and a hydrocarbyl group, R 2 is selected from the group consisting of a hydrogen, a hydrocarbyl group, and a halogen, and R 3 is selected from the group consisting of a hydrogen and a hydrocarbyl group; and forming said 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ine, wherein the hydrocarbyl group is selected from the group consisting of an alkyl group, a cycloalkyl group, and an aryl group;

(B) forming an adduct of said 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ine and said primary hydrocarbyl amine;

(C) precipitating said adduct; and

(D) decomposing said adduct to produce said 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ein step (A) is performed in the presence of an acid catalyst.

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ein steps (A) and (B) are performed simultaneously by performing the heating in step (A) with an excess of said primary hydrocarbyl amine to form said adduct in situ.

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ein after step (A) and before step (B) the 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3,-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ine is isolated in crude form, and step (B) is performed by dissolving the crude 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3,-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ine with a further amount of the primary hydrocarbyl amine.

5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ising neutralizing the reaction mixture prior to precipitating said adduct, wherein neutralizing comprises adding a base to the reaction mixture.

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ein said step (B) is performed by adding at least 3 moles of primary hydrocarbyl amine in the reaction mixture.

7. The method of claim 4 , wherein said crude 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ine is reacted with at least 2 moles of primary hydrocarbyl amine.

8. The method of claim 1 , wherein said step (D) of decomposing the adduct comprises heating said adduct with an aliphatic alcohol.

9. The method of claim 8 , wherein said aliphatic alcohol is selected from the group consisting of methanol, ethanol, iso-propanol, iso-butanol, n-butanol, tertiary butanol, n-pentanol, iso-pentanol, and mixtures of at least one the foregoing aliphatic alcohols.

10. The method of claim 1 , wherein said step (D) of decomposing the adduct comprises the steps of:

dissolving said precipitated adduct in an aqueous base to provide a first solution;

mixing the first solution with a water-immiscible aromatic hydrocarbon solvent, to form, an aqueous layer and an organic layer;

treating the aqueous layer with a solid adsorbent to provide a second solution; and

adding an aqueous acid to the second solution to precipitate said 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ine.

11. The method of claim 10 , wherein said mixing of said first solution with the aromatic hydrocarbon solvent is done at least twice.

12. The method of claim 10 , wherein said aqueous base comprises an additive selected from the group consisting of; an alkali metal, alkaline earth metal hydroxides, carbonates, and bicarbonates.

13. The method of claim 1 , wherein the step (D) further comprises the steps of heating said 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ine with an aliphatic alcohol.

14. The method of claim 13 , wherein said aliphatic alcohol is selected from the group consisting of; methanol, ethanol, iso-propanol, iso-butanol, n-butanol, tertiary butanol, n-pentanol, iso-pentanol, and mixtures comprising at least one the foregoing aliphatic alcohols.

15. The method of claim 2 , wherein said acid catalyst is selected from the group consisting of a substituted or an unsubstituted aliphatic amine hydrochloride, an aromatic amine hydrochloride, and mixtures of the foregoing amine hydrochlorides.

16. The method of claim 1 , wherein said step (A) of heating the reaction mixture is conducted at a temperature of 140° C. to 185° C.

17. The method of claim 1 , wherein said step (A) of heating the reaction mixture is conducted at a temperature of 140° C. to 150° C.

18. The method of claim 1 , wherein said step (A) of heating the reaction mixture further comprises removing a distillate comprising water.

19. The method of claim 1 , wherein said step (A) of heating the reaction mixture has a duration of 4 hours to 48 hours.

20. The method of claim 1 , wherein said step (A) of heating the reaction mixture has a duration of 22 hours to 30 hours.

21. The method of claim 10 , wherein said water-immiscible aromatic hydrocarbon solvent comprises a solvent selected from the group consisting of toluene, isomeric xylenes or mixtures thereof, chlorobenzene, and mesitylene.

22. The method of claim 1 , wherein said 2-hydrocarby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yaryl)phthalimidine is 2-pheny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xphenyl)phthalimidine.

23. The method of claim 22 , wherein said 2-pheny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yphenyl)phthalimidine comprises less than or equal to 1,500 parts per million of phenolphthalein based on total weight of 2-phenyl-3,3-bis(4-hydroxyphenyl)phthalimidine.
